Neptune Awards

  • Winner of 2 National Tourism Awards for two consecutive years by Ministry of Tourism – Government of India - For Best Domestic Tour Operator - North East and ROI (Rest of India)

    The National Tourism Awards 2017-18 were given on World Tourism Day, 27 September 2019 by Hon'ble Union Minister of State for Tourism and Culture (I/C) Shri Prahlad Singh Patel and Mr. Zurab Pololikashvili is Secretary-General of the World Tourism Organization (UNWTO)

  • National Award Winner for Best Domestic Tour Operator (2016-17)

    The Award was received by our Directors Mr. Chandra Prakash Bhatter and Mr. Sanjay Jhawar on 27 September 2018 from Mr. Alphons Kannanthanam, Minister of Tourism, Govt. of India
